Sidelink data transmission method for ultra-low latency and high reliability communication in wireless communication system and apparatus therefor

1. A method for transmitting and receiving data by a first user equipment (UE) in a communication system, the method comprising:
receiving sidelink repetitive transmission information from a base station;
performing physical sidelink shared channel (PSSCH) repetitive transmissions including sidelink data for a second UE based on the sidelink repetitive transmission information, the sidelink repetitive transmission information including at least one of a first number of repetitive transmissions for the PSSCH, and time/frequency resource information used for repetitive transmissions of the PSSCH; and
determining a second number of repetitive transmissions for the PSSCH based on response information received by the first UE from the second UE in response to the PSSCH repetitive transmissions,
wherein the second number of repetitive transmissions is equal to, greater than, or less than the first number of repetitive transmissions.
